Join us as a Security Operations Centre Analyst where you will be responsible for monitoring and responding to security threats. You will play a critical role in protecting sensitive data and ensuring compliance with regulatory requirements.
Responsibilities
Identify, track, and remediate vulnerabilities within the infrastructure.
Develop incident response strategies and communication plans.
Conduct regular training sessions for employees regarding security awareness.
Prepare for and participate in security audits and compliance reviews.
Stay informed about legal and regulatory requirements related to cybersecurity.
Foster a culture of security-awareness within the organization.
Collaborate with external security teams for incident response drills.
